Brer Rabbit's Christmas Carol (Animated) (DVD)

That old bah-humbug Brer Fox is in for an eye-opening Christmas when Brer Rabbit's Dickensian scheme scares goodwill into him. An animated children's tale.

Blackadder's Christmas Carol is a one-off comedy special, a parody on Charles Dickens' "A Christmas Carol". Timeline wise it's set between the third and the fourth series, and is narrated by Hugh Laurie. Ebenezer Blackadder owns a shop in Victorian England. In a brilliant twist on Blackadder and on Scrooge, he is widely regarded as the nicest man in England. He will go out of his way for anyone and would give away his last penny if it made someone happy. As a result of this though, he is taken advantage of all time, as people know he never says no to anyone. One person who doesn't though is his assistant, Mr. Baldrick, who for once is actually content in his job. But Ebenezer is lonely and miserable, his shop never makes a profit because he gives it all away and he never keeps anything for himself. That all changes though one ...
